BOSTON (WHDH) – In a video posted to social media, Vermont-based singer-songwriter Noah Kahan was seen wearing a custom Fenway Park jacket during his sold-out four-night stint at the ballpark. 7NEWS caught up with the Maine designer who created the piece, and she said it was a dream come true.
Daphne Murphy, the Owner and Designer of Daphne Michelle Designs, said she has been making the custom jackets for a year, and she had an extra special one in mind for Kahan.
“I already had the jacket in mind, but I hadn’t made it yet. It was made custom for him. I was very careful with how it came together,” Murphy said. “They’re made from…a season ticket holder blanket, and they say ‘Fenway’ on the back.”…
